Transaction 2b1e2f8785379fee3786b21765b200c38d4824d5f270ea82743fdfacc74616fa
2 Input
2 Outputs
- 2b1e2f8785379fee3786b21765b200c38d4824d5f270ea82743fdfacc74616fa:0
- 2b1e2f8785379fee3786b21765b200c38d4824d5f270ea82743fdfacc74616fa:1
value 2518110
address 14dtHzWybbEVMGDVPBczWQZRJqw9HLenVx
value 42210464
address 368YtqYeU57XZvMCtfdugVQyX1LH7oYPBU